The Avenger was deploy on ETO on 1942, to hunt submarines on the Atlantic on the Hunter Killers CVL groups, with near 35 Uboats sunk with radar, flares, sonobouis, rockets, bombs, depth charges and ASW torpedoes with assitance of Wildcats fighters.

I was ready to make the same thread myself, but yeah the B-25 is a great idea, not only is it a shut-up-and-take-my-money module if full fidelity for me, but it seems like a logical next step for DCS. We fairly recently got the first set of radial engine planes modeled wonderfully. Then we got the first twin in the form of the Mosquito. Next up: twin radial. And in the far future assuming it is executed well it may open the possibility for larger and more complex bombers from the era. Where the sim is right now and the developers experience this seems like the next sort of healthy challenge, the next rung in the ladder toward things like the B-17 or B-29 someday.

But back to my main point, as mentioned by others, the B-25 served in most theaters and was super versatile. That is important because having such a module developed gives each potential buyer more reasons to consider it (think F-18s popularity), whereas if they went for the B-26 there is a lot of scenarios of combat and gameplay where it just would not be able to do anything. 

The B-25 as far as I'm aware had all kinds of weapons; forward facing guns, bombs(obviously), parachute bombs, rockets, flares, and even torpedo's as well.
